[Detailed Description of the Invention] Industrial Field of Application/Related Applications This invention relates to a two-story bus with an improved ceiling.

BACKGROUND TECHNOLOGY, OBJECTIVES AND PROBLEMS In conventional two-story buses, the total vehicle height is limited, so it has been difficult to maintain a sufficient ceiling height from the aisle surface.

Therefore, the purpose and problem of this invention is to provide a two-story bus that has a higher ceiling height from the aisle surface and allows smooth boarding and alighting.

Explanation of Specific Examples The second floor bus of this invention will be explained below based on the specific examples shown in the drawings.
An embodiment 10 of a two-story bus of the invention is shown in which a plurality of longitudinal steel beams and transverse steel beams 12 support a roof panel (not shown) and Its transverse beam 12
However, in the central part of the ceiling 13 corresponding to the second floor passage 18, the beam thickness is made thinner than in the parts 14 and 15 on both sides of the beam, and the beam width is made wider and the lower surface of the beam is recessed upward. It was manufactured with a cross-sectional shape of .

As such, the transverse beam 12 has been modified in cross-sectional shape to provide sufficient strength, so that the upper surface of the central ceiling portion 13 and the side beam portions 14, 15, in order to support the roof panel, That is, the outer surfaces are aligned with each other. In other words, the transverse beam 12 extends the neutral plane of the central ceiling portion 13 to both side portions 1 of the beam.
The cross-sectional shape was changed so that it was located further outside than that of Nos. 4 and 15.

Therefore, the transverse beam 12 is
Since the ceiling center portion 13 corresponding to the floor passage 18 is deformed in cross section and the lower surface of the beam is recessed upward, the second floor bus 10 has a
The ceiling height from the aisle has been raised, making it easier to get on and off the train.

Convenience/benefits of the invention According to this invention, the horizontal beam in the ceiling above the second-floor passageway is thinner in the central part of the ceiling corresponding to the second-floor passageway than in the beam thickness on both sides of the beam. In addition, since the beam width is widened and the lower surface of the beam is recessed into the upper surface, the ceiling height from the aisle surface becomes higher in the second floor aisle, making it easier for passengers on the second floor of the bus to become mobile and thus facilitate getting on and off the bus.
